WebThe two forms of clinical listeriosis seen in sheep are the neurological form and the abortion form. Neurological form: can affect any breed and at any age often circling, staggering, head tilt, off-feed, found dead Abortion form: affected pregnant ewes of any age in the second to final month of pregnancy
